    <ok> Spot on G10.

    The academy staff deserve great praise for the way Caulker has developed.

    Whoever decided to send him on his respected loan spells must also have a special mention, each spell at Yeovil, Bristol and Swansea he blossomed and improved game by game and it was an important decision to make sure he joined the right clubs for his development. He won 4 out 5 POTY awards at Yeovil, YPOTY at Bristol City and was a nominee for their POTY and then Swansea fans flooded our boards of their praise for him and how they wanted him back.

    Well done academy staff and well done Caulker!
